Welcome to the Quillhaven release track. The websocket reconnect bug in Marlowe Relay causes clients to double-subscribe after a dropped connection, inflating fan-out metrics. The fix ships behind the relay_dedupe flag; verify it against the staging broker before sign-off. To query the broker's internal diagnostics endpoint, you will need the service credential that follows.

service key, yadup-tagag: kto2_62

## Service Accounts — StormFan Alert Fan-Out

The fan-out worker authenticates to the internal dispatch tier using the svc-stormfan account. Rotate quarterly; scopes are limited to publish-only on alert topics. If deliveries stall during your shift, verify the worker is using the current credential, reproduced below for reference.

API key for kaweg-hahif: kto4_rAjZ

## Onboarding: Audit-Log Viewer

Welcome to the Tallgrass audit-log viewer team. The viewer reads append-only event streams from the Coppervane store and renders them with per-tenant filtering, so take care never to point a dev instance at production streams. Clone the repo, run the bootstrap script, and copy the sample env file into place. Then append the read-only stream access secret on the line immediately below.

env line for hahap-yahap: RELAY_SECRET20=ddd9a6e229d82513cc5d